December 24, 1942 ~ March 09, 2024

John W. Serraes passed away on March 9, 2024.  John was a friend to everyone and the life of the party.  He retired from Florida Public Utilities n/k/a Chesapeake Utilities where he was employed for 50 years.  John served in the U.S. Army Reserves and Lake Park Police Reserves.  He was also a member of the Knights of Columbus. John loved gardening and animals.  He is survived by his beloved wife, Theresa, of 60 years, daughter-Linda, son-Mark, his dog Maggie, grand dog Noah, and grand rabbit Jack. In lieu of flowers, the family asks that you consider donations to Furry Friends Animal Shelter, 100 Capital St, Jupiter, FL 33458 or Leukemia & Lymphoma Society www.lls.org.  Memorial to be held on March 20, 2024 at 10:00 a.m. at St. Patrick’s Catholic Church, 13591 Prosperity Farms Rd, Palm Beach Gardens, FL 33410.  Committal service at Riverside Memorial Park will be private.
